OREANDA-NEWS. September 20, 2016. The enterprise is moving steadily toward hybrid cloud infrastructures, with more and more organizations committing to “cloud-first” strategies. Industry experts are bullish about hybrid cloud growth and IDC predicts that more than 80% of enterprises will commit to hybrid cloud architectures by 2017.

As enterprises increasingly adopt hybrid clouds and integrate them into their IT infrastructures, they are seeing direct interconnection as critical to their digital strategies. The ability to directly connect to a range of cloud services globally solves a host of problems for the enterprise by enabling secure, flexible, high-performance interconnection to whatever cloud services its users or applications need, from wherever they are.

Interconnection Comes First

In the digital age, businesses must be able to reach users anytime, anywhere, on any device – that “omnichannel” experience is simply the default expectation nowadays. The enterprise is also adopting new collaboration and commerce models that require instant and simultaneous connectivity between partners, often in different global regions, just to execute basic business tasks.

And the growing importance of the Internet of Things (IoT) and associated trends such as big data mean that to stay out in front of the competition, businesses need to be able to quickly and securely access huge data stores, data processing applications and analytics services so they can gain the insight they need from the deluge the data streaming in from the IoT.

The enterprise can’t meet these demands without the cloud, and they know it. Most are selecting and prioritizing which workloads and applications to migrate to and operate there and which to keep on site. So for the foreseeable future, the enterprise will need a platform that allows them to operate both on-premise private clouds and public cloud workloads and applications, and that’s the hybrid cloud.

Oracle FastConnect gives enterprises direct and secure access to Oracle Cloud from four locations spanning North America and Europe, and a fifth location will soon be available in Australia. This private route bypasses the public Internet, for low latency and superior performance. Private connections also greatly reduce the enterprise attack surface, adding a critical level of security. Overall, the interconnection Oracle FastConnect delivers establishes a hybrid cloud capability that allows the enterprise to maximize the Oracle Cloud.
